Prophet predicts US election outcome, warns Kamala Harris of challenges in key battleground states

Ahead of the 2024 US election, Prophet Ayodele warns Kamala Harris to focus on key states to secure victory, predicting a tough battle against Trump.

 

 

[dropcap]A[/dropcap]head of the high-stakes 2024 US presidential election, where Democrat Kamala Harris and Republican Donald Trump compete for the crucial 270 electoral college votes out of 538, popular Nigerian prophet Primate Ayodele has made a bold prediction.

The respected leader of the INRI Evangelical Spiritual Church forecasted a potential victory for Donald Trump if Kamala Harris fails to focus on key battleground states.

In an exclusive interview with Global Excellence magazine on Friday, 25 October 2024, at his ministry’s Lagos office, Primate Ayodele outlined the states Harris must target to succeed in her bid for the presidency.

During the interview, Primate Ayodele warned Harris to intensify her efforts in specific swing states, notably Iowa, North Carolina, Texas, Pennsylvania, Kentucky, Wisconsin, Oklahoma, and Arkansas.

He advised her to make an impactful showing, even in states traditionally favouring Trump. “Kamala Harris must work hard.

If Kamala can focus on these states, along with expected Democratic strongholds like California, Colorado, Connecticut, Delaware, Hawaii, New Jersey, New York, Maryland, Illinois, and Oregon, I see her victory as the next US president,” Primate Ayodele proclaimed.

The prophet, renowned for his accurate predictions, noted that Donald Trump was simultaneously working to flip pivotal states such as Pennsylvania, Georgia, and North Carolina—states that had supported the Democratic Party in 2020.

Primate Ayodele warned that Harris would face serious challenges unless Democrats rallied to her support, particularly in these competitive regions.

With each state carrying unique electoral weight, Ayodele’s predictions underscore the complexity and volatility of the electoral process.

The outcome may well depend on how successfully Harris heeds these warnings, especially in swing states that are crucial to gaining the White House.

As the election nears, political analysts and voters alike are watching closely, particularly given Ayodele’s historical accuracy in previous predictions.

The question remains: will Harris heed these prophetic insights and secure the required electoral college votes, or will Trump prevail with strategic gains in swing states? The world is waiting for the answer.
